About
Dungeon Punks, released in 2016, is an engaging blend of adventure and hack-and-slash gameplay that immerses players in an old-school arcade atmosphere. This indie RPG offers exciting tag-team fighting mechanics where players can alternate between characters, such as unleashing powerful freeze blasts with a genie and following up with a dwarf's fiery bomb attacks. Its unique combination of genres and fresh gameplay features make it a notable title for fans of retro-style games.
